How Herbal Teas Are A Blessing 🙏🏼

Herbal teas have been used for centuries as natural remedies for a variety of health issues. Unlike traditional teas, herbal teas are made from a combination of herbs, spices, and other plant materials, and do not contain any caffeine.

One of the most popular herbal teas is chamomile tea, which is made from the dried flowers of the chamomile plant. Chamomile tea is known for its calming properties and is often used to help people relax and fall asleep. It is also said to have anti-inflammatory and anti-bacterial properties.

Another popular herbal tea is peppermint tea, which is made from dried peppermint leaves. Peppermint tea is known for its refreshing and cooling effect and is often used to help soothe digestive issues such as bloating and nausea.

Ginger tea is also a popular herbal tea, particularly in Asian cultures, and is made from fresh ginger root. Ginger tea is known for its anti-inflammatory properties and is often used to help relieve sore throats and reduce inflammation in the body.

Rooibos tea, also known as red tea, is made from the leaves of the rooibos plant, which is native to South Africa. Rooibos tea is rich in antioxidants and is often used to help boost the immune system and reduce inflammation in the body.

Herbal teas are also believed to have a range of other health benefits, including reducing stress and anxiety, improving digestion, and supporting the immune system. However, it is important to note that while herbal teas are generally considered safe, they should not be used as a replacement for medical treatment and should be consumed in moderation.
